### Jerry Jones Lashes Out During Radio Appearance Over Cowboys’ Loss

Dallas Cowboys owner Jerry Jones didn’t hold back during his recent appearance on “Shan & RJ” on Audacy’s 105.3 The Fan. Following a disheartening 47-9 home loss to the Detroit Lions that coincided with his 82nd birthday, Jones had a heated exchange with the show’s hosts, expressing his frustration.

The contentious moment arose when the hosts raised questions about the team’s offseason roster decisions. Jones felt they were overly focused on the negatives and offered this sharp retort: “If you think I’m interested in a damn phone call with you… you have gotta be smoking something.” He warned the hosts they could be replaced if their questioning didn’t improve.

Amidst chuckles from the hosts, Jones insisted he was serious, stating they would never grasp the complexities of team decisions unless they attended NFL meetings. He referenced his own contentious choices, recalling buying the team, which he initially deemed a poor decision, yet ultimately proved beneficial. Despite his anger, Jones expressed hope for the Cowboys’ future.
